单击键盘中的完成时如何避免调用 ExpandableListView 中的 getChildView

How to avoid getChildView in ExpandableListView getting called when clicking on done in keypad

我在 ExpandableListView 的其中一个子项中有 Edittext。在 EditText 中,当单击键盘中的完成按钮时,getChildView 被调用 automatically.How 以避免这种情况。我也想知道为什么调用 getChildView unnecessarily.Anybody 帮我找出答案。

我的猜测是事件:KeyEvent.KEYCODE_ENTER 被发送到您的 ExpandableListView,在这种情况下,调用 getChildView 是很正常的。

如果您想避免这种情况,只需覆盖侦听器或使 ExpandableListView 失去焦点。